RASHIDI v. AMERICAN PRESIDENT LINES

No. 95-31027.

96 F.3d 124 (1996)

Youssery F. RASHIDI,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. AMERICAN PRESIDENT LINES, United States of America, and Comet V53, Defendants-Appellees.

United States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it.

September 26, 1996.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Kevin C. Schoenberger, New Orleans, LA, for Youssery F. Rashidi, plaintiff-appellant.

Michelle Terry Delemarre, United States Department of Justice, Washington, DC, for defendants-appellees.

Before SMITH and PARKER, Circuit Judges, and JUSTICE, District Judge.


JERRY E. SMITH, Circuit Judge:

Youssery Rashidi appeals the judgment that his claim for maintenance and cure under the Suits in Admiralty Act (the "SAA"), 46 U.S.C.App. § 742, is time-barred. Finding no error, we affirm.
